| | |
| | | */ |
| | | @Data |
| | | public class DataCenterQuery extends AbsQuery { |
| | | @JsonFormat(pattern = "yyyy-MM-dd",timezone = "GMT+8") |
| | | private Date date; |
| | | |
| | | /** 开始时间 */ |
| | | @JsonFormat(pattern = "yyyy-MM-dd") |
| | | private Date startTime; |
| | | |
| | | /** 结束时间 */ |
| | | @JsonFormat(pattern = "yyyy-MM-dd") |
| | | private Date endTime; |
| | | |
| | | /** 关键词 */ |
| | |
| | | |
| | | /** 1 视频 2 车辆 3 人脸 */ |
| | | private Integer deviceType; |
| | | |
| | | /** 下拉框 */ |
| | | private Integer option; |
| | | |
| | | public void setTime() { |
| | | if (Objects.nonNull(this.startTime)) { |
| | | this.startTime = DateUtils.getDayStart(this.startTime); |
| | | if (Objects.nonNull(this.date)) { |
| | | this.startTime = DateUtils.getDayStart(this.date); |
| | | } |
| | | if (Objects.nonNull(this.endTime)) { |
| | | this.endTime = DateUtils.getDayEnd(this.endTime); |
| | | if (Objects.nonNull(this.date)) { |
| | | this.endTime = DateUtils.getDayEnd(this.date); |
| | | } |
| | | } |
| | | |